WebMay 8, 2024 · 60 to 70% of our body is water. It’s a bit higher for newborns (77%) and men have more water in their bodies than women. Organs with high amounts of water are the lungs (83%), muscles and kidneys (79%), and the heart and brain (73%). Even the bones are for 31% water! We need to drink about two liters of water a day to stay healthy.

Drinking more water while dieting and exercising may just help you lose extra pounds. how do you prevent anemiaWebWater helps keep your temperature normal. You need water to digest your food and get rid of waste. Water is needed for digestive juices, urine (pee), and poop. And you can bet that water is the main ingredient in perspiration, also called sweat.
